Panduit FW2RLU1U1NNM028 OM5 28M LC Duplex LSZH Fiber Cable

Overview

The Panduit FW2RLU1U1NNM028 is a 28-meter (91.9 ft) OM5 wideband multimode duplex fiber optic cable, terminated with LC connectors on both ends. Its Low Smoke Zero Halogen (LSZH) jacket makes it suitable for environments where fire safety is paramount, such as data centers, telecommunications rooms, and equipment distribution areas. This pre-terminated cable infrastructure is designed for rapid deployment, reducing installation time and complexity for high-speed data transmission needs.

Compatibility

This Panduit QuickNet™ cable is designed for use with LC Duplex fiber optic transceivers and equipment requiring OM5 wideband multimode fiber. It meets TIA-568.3-D, ISO/IEC 11801, and ANSI/TIA-942-B standards, ensuring interoperability with compliant network hardware in enterprise and data center environments. Its specific application is supporting pre-terminated fiber infrastructure for rapid deployment in areas like data centers, telecom rooms, and equipment distribution areas.

Installation Notes

The LSZH jacket provides enhanced safety in plenum spaces or areas with stringent fire codes, minimizing toxic smoke and corrosive byproducts in case of fire. The uniboot design with LC connectors allows for easy polarity management and a cleaner cable pathway, reducing congestion. OM5 fiber supports higher bandwidth applications, including 400G Ethernet, over shorter distances compared to single-mode fiber, making it ideal for switch-to-switch or server-to-switch connections within racks or rows.

Specifications
Cable Category: fiber_optic
Application: Data centers, telecommunications rooms, entrance facilities, and equipment distribution areas requiring pre-terminated fiber infrastructure for rapid deployment.
Connector Type: LC Duplex
Fiber Type: OM5 Wideband Multimode (50/125µm)
Flammability Rating: Low Smoke Zero Halogen (LSZH)
Fiber Count: 2
Length Ft: 91.9
Length M: 28
Standards: TIA-568.3-D, ISO/IEC 11801, ANSI/TIA-942-B
Sub Brand: QuickNet™
